In this paper, we propose a new routing algorithm for the general incomplete star interconnection network (GISN). The diameter of GISN is shown to be bounded by 3.5n-5. This improves on a 4n-7 routing algorithm described earlier in Shi Yutao, et al., (2002). We also prove that the diameter of GISN is more than or equals to lfloor3(n-2)/2rfloor+1.
